Virtual Muslin Screens: Perfecting Chromakey Looks
Creating realistic effects with green screen technology relies heavily on a quality muslin backdrop. This fabric-based system offers a affordable way to eliminate your background and add digital elements. Proper lighting is essential – minimizing shadows and ensuring uniform illumination is key to a flawless key. Here's how to begin with muslin screens:
- Choose the appropriate green hue - a medium green typically works greatest.
- Verify the backdrop is flat – wrinkles can lead to unwanted artifacts.
- Maintain a appropriate distance away the subject and the backdrop to limit green light.
Experimenting with different camera angles will assist you to produce professional-looking results.
